WebThe safety factors were calculated for each layer using the max stress, Tsai-Wu, Puck, Tsai-Hill, Hoffmann and Hashin failure criteria . The failure criterion of Tsai-Wu ( Table 1 ) includes a constant of a xy that must be between −1 and 1, but despite numerous studies by different authors [ 32 , 42 , 43 ], there is still no universal equation for its determination.
